Istanbul Sees Surge in Water Consumption Amid Summer Heatwave
Istanbul has experienced a significant increase in water consumption due to rising summer temperatures, with daily usage surpassing 3.5 million cubic meters. The city's water authority, ISKI, has reported this surge as a response to the hot weather conditions.

As temperatures soar in Istanbul with the arrival of summer, the city's water consumption has reached unprecedented levels. According to a report from the Istanbul Water and Sewerage Administration (ISKI), water usage in the city exceeded 3 million 568 thousand 162 cubic meters as of yesterday. This spike in consumption highlights the growing demand for water as residents cope with the heat.
ISKI officials attribute the increase in water usage to the rising temperatures that accompany the summer season. With many residents seeking relief from the heat, activities such as swimming, gardening, and general cooling have contributed to this record high in water consumption. The water authority is closely monitoring usage patterns to ensure adequate supply during these peak demand periods.
The significant rise in water consumption not only reflects the challenges posed by hot weather but also emphasizes the importance of water conservation. Officials encourage residents to use water wisely and implement measures to reduce waste, especially during the hottest days of the year. As Istanbul continues to experience extreme temperatures, maintaining sustainable water usage will be crucial for the cityโs long-term resource management.
